if all your going to be thinking about while at the track is crashing, than you shouldnt be there. Its a risk no matter what car you take, be sure you have good seatbelts and seats (factory are fine) and go have fun learning how to go fast.

I have been tracking my car for 4 years, seen 2 240 wrecks non-drift related, both were rollovers, one at slow speed due to complete driver negligence and the other was a race car that was off line and rolled 3x, but the cage kept the roof in good enough condition to continue racing the next day.

UPDATE!!!

Summit Point Raceway Aug 22-23

Last time on Summit this year, i went out for a last run with my HPDE1 student in his stock S14 with just coilovers and HP+ brake pads. Picking up lots of corner speed, adjusting lines and closing in on some form of consistency. Coming through T10 onto the front strait we came in a bit hot with a touch of an early turn in or maybe just a little too much speed. Driver put 2 left wheels off the pavement and tried to get back op on track. In an instant the car pitched 90* and shot back across track to the infield where we slammed into a tirewall in front of a concrete barrier. I hurt my chest pretty badly and went to the hospital for x-ray's, everything came back good, minus the bruises on my chest. Car is totaled, driver is fine, im bruised up and i lost my chatter box. All in all im happy to be ok and working out a way to get in touch with the driver to make sure hes taking it all ok.
